Iran (IMNA) - Speaking to reporters on the sidelines of a cabinet meeting, Araghchi noted that Iran had recently engaged in talks with Germany, France, and Britain in Geneva, focusing on nuclear issues and other matters, which experienced both progress and setbacks.
Araghchi highlighted that extensive discussions were held with Lavrov on regional and bilateral matters. He stressed that while Lavrov shared insights into Russia's negotiations with the U.S. and regional states, he did not carry any message from Washington, nor was he expected to do so. This development comes as Iran continues to navigate its diplomatic relationships amidst ongoing tensions with the United States.
